Baloca
Baloca is a hamlet in São Miguel do Mato, Arouca, Aveiro District. Baloca is situated nearby to the hamlet Viso, as well as near Baía.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Louredo
Village
Louredo is a former civil parish in the municipality of Santa Maria da Feira, Portugal. In 2013, the parish merged into the new parish Lobão, Gião, Louredo e Guisande. It has a population of 1,459 inhabitants and a total area of 8.67 km2. Louredo is situated 6 km west of Baloca.
Canedo
Town
Canedo is a former civil parish in the municipality of Santa Maria da Feira, Portugal. In 2013, the parish merged into the new parish Canedo, Vale e Vila Maior. It has a population of 5,782 inhabitants and a total area of 27.81 km2. Canedo is situated 7 km northwest of Baloca.
